For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 577 students in the neighborhood of Center City East, Philadelphia, PA.
The top ranked public middle school in Center City East is Mastery Chs-lenfest Campus.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of Center City East, Philadelphia, PA public middle school have an average math proficiency score of 20% (versus the Pennsylvania public middle school average of 29%), and reading proficiency score of 30% (versus the 52%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Pennsylvania public middle school average of 46% (majority Black and Hispanic).
